
Ile Ife
Ile Ife is an ancient city in Nigeria, often regarded as the spiritual and cultural heart of the Yoruba people. It is considered the birthplace of humanity in Yoruba mythology, particularly as the home of the creator deity, Oduduwa. Historically, Ile Ife was a major center for art and trade, renowned for its intricate brass and terracotta sculptures. Today, it remains an important site for Yoruba heritage, hosting festivals and museums that celebrate its rich cultural legacy and influence on Nigerian history.
